I just tried byte-compiling the patched file and got the following
warning:
ELC erc/erc-desktop-notifications.elc
In toplevel form:
erc/erc-desktop-notifications.el:74:1:
Warning: Unused lexical argument ‘proc’
Since this arises because of lexical-binding, could you please also add
an underscore to the name of the PROC argument in
erc-notifications-PRIVMSG?
